JUA 390N is a 1975 Triumph Stag in White with a 3,528c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 1975 Triumph Stag models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.4% with a typical mileage of 54,677 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Triumph Stag fails its MOT is windscreen washer provides insufficient washer liquid, accounting for 2,039 recorded failures. If you're considering buying JUA 390N,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Triumph Stag typically stays on UK roads for around 56 years. At 51 years old, this Triumph Stag is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
